服务注册

下面,我们将user-service注册到eureka-server中去。

1)引入依赖

在user-service的pom文件中,引入下面的eureka-client依赖:

<dependency><groupId>org.springframework.cloud</groupId><artifactId>spring-cloud-starter-netflix-eureka-client</artifactId>
</dependency>

2)配置文件

在user-service中,修改application.yml文件,添加服务名称、eureka地址:

spring:application:name: userservice
eureka:client:service-url:defaultZone: http://127.0.0.1:10086/eureka

3)启动多个user-service实例

为了演示一个服务有多个实例的场景,我们添加一个SpringBoot的启动配置,再启动一个user-service。

首先,复制原来的user-service启动配置:

然后,在弹出的窗口中,填写信息:

现在,SpringBoot窗口会出现两个user-service启动配置:

不过,第一个是8081端口,第二个是8082端口。

启动两个user-service实例:

查看eureka-server管理页面:

Eureka-服务注册相关推荐

  1. Eureka服务注册中心

    Eureka服务注册中心 最近在研究Spring Cloud,发现其中的组件实在是太多了,真的是头大,只能一块一块看,像盲人摸象一样.要想很短时间内掌握Spring Cloud是不可能的,小编就学习一 ...

  2. SpringCloud组件 源码剖析:Eureka服务注册方式流程全面分析

    在SpringCloud组件:Eureka服务注册是采用主机名还是IP地址?文章中我们讲到了服务注册的几种注册方式,那么这几种注册方式的源码是怎么实现的呢?我们带着这一个疑问来阅读本章内容能够让你更深 ...

  3. 详解Eureka服务注册与发现和Ribbon负载均衡【纯理论实战】

    Eureka服务注册与发现 Eureka简介 在介绍Eureka前,先说一下CAP原则 CAP原则又称CAP定理,指的是在一个分布式系统中,Consistency(一致性). Availability ...

  4. Eureka服务注册中心---SpringCloud

    Eureka服务注册中心 5.1 什么是Eureka Netflix在涉及Eureka时,遵循的就是API原则. Eureka是Netflix的有个子模块,也是核心模块之一.Eureka是基于REST ...

  5. Eureka服务注册源码分析

    本文来说下Eureka服务注册源码 文章目录 Eureka-Client注册服务 啥时候会注册 定时器注册 自动注册 DiscoveryClient.register() Eureka-Server接 ...

  6. Eureka 服务注册中心的探究

    文章目录 Eureka 服务注册中心的探究 1.什么是 Eureka 2.Eureka 相对于其他注册中心组件对Spring Cloud 的优势 3.Eureka 的架构 Eureka 服务注册中心的 ...

  7. SpringCloud笔记(Hoxton)——Netflix之Eureka服务注册与发现

    基础应用 Eureka简介 Eureka是一个基于REST的服务,主要在AWS云中使用,定位服务来进行中间层服务器的负载均衡和故障转移. SpringCloud封装了Netflix公司开发的Eurek ...

  8. 《微服务系列:Eureka服务注册发现中心》

    说在前头:本人为大二在读学生,书写文章的目的是为了对自己掌握的知识和技术进行一定的记录,同时乐于与大家一起分享,因本人资历尚浅,能力有限,文章难免存在一些错漏之处,还请阅读此文章的大牛们见谅与斧正.若 ...

  9. 二、Eureka服务注册与发现

    SpringCloud系列目录: 一.SpringCloud简介 二.Eureka服务注册与发现 三.Eureka注册与发现之Eureka Comsumer 四.Eureka.Server Provi ...

  10. SpringCloud[01]Eureka服务注册与发现

    文章目录 Eureka服务注册与发现 1. Eureka基础知识 1. 什么是服务治理 2. 什么是服务注册与发现 3. Eureka包含两个组件:**Eureka Server** 和 **Eure ...

最新文章

  1. 深度学习(4)基础4 -- 神经网络架构激活函数过拟合处理
  2. Premiere做影片时四周的黑框
  3. ASP.NET MVC Html.ActionLink使用说明
  4. 2017-2018-2 20179204《网络攻防实践》第八周学习总结
  5. HashSet源码分析
  6. 浏览器外部署Silverlight更新检查失败的原因及对策
  7. Shell——变量详解及注意点
  8. POJ3264Balanced Lineup(最基础的线段树)
  9. 查看php 加载.dll,无法加载PHP_OCI8.DLL的解决
  10. Spring Cloud Gateway (七)处理流程解析
  11. 通过ln链接目录到目标
  12. python云台控制原理_python伺服云台摄像头图像作为背景
  13. Context-Aware Patch Generation for Better Automated Program Repair -上下文感知补丁生成更好的自动化程序修复
  14. 数据库文档自动生成工具
  15. mysql当前时间相减_mysql 查询当前时间加减时间
  16. 【项目】 基于BOOST的站内搜索引擎
  17. SuperMap GIS 9D 产品白皮书v1.0
  18. 苹果开发者账号官方翻译篇-团队管理
  19. 链表-1(链表理论基础、移除链表元素、设计链表翻转链表)
  20. minio分布式集群搭建完全教程(纠删码,数据恢复)

热门文章

  1. 更改Mysql数据库存储位置的具体步骤
  2. 标准C++的类型转换符:static_cast、dynamic_cast、reinterpret_cast和const_cast(转载)
  3. docker+httpd的安装
  4. 一站式学习Redis 从入门到高可用分布式实践(慕课)第六章 Redis开发运维常见问题...
  5. linux-VM无法连接mks套接字连接尝试次数太多
  6. Python: ImportRequestsError: No module named 'requests'解决方法
  7. node中异步IO的理解
  8. JS实现图片预览与等比缩放
  9. IntellIJ IDEA 配置 Maven 以及 修改 默认 Repository
  10. 我最印象深刻的编程错误经历